As the nation celebrates the centennial of the 19th Amendment's ratification, join local author Patricia Cuff to learn the fascinating story of this achievement.
Join us for a discussion with author Patricia Cuff, author of Alice Paul, a Suffragist for Today as well as Lucy Burns, a Passionate Rebel to learn more about the ratification of the 19th Amendment, highlighting the dedicated women - and men - who achieved it. Ms. Cuff lives in Montgomery Village and is a former high school and college English professor. There will be time for audience questions.
